    Hm.. I might be wrong, but RivaTuner should still be able to do that.. just run it in Administrator mode (and if you're running Vista x64 - then you'll have to disable driver signing too).
    The bad part is that yes, it's not compatible with the 100.xx drivers, but the low-level hardware module should still work ;)
